Taguig hosts LCP event on knowledge-sharing
Taguig City recently hosted a 2-day knowledge-sharing event of the League of Cities of the Philippines (LCP) entitled "Sustainability Enablers: Cities Achieving the SDGs" at the Seda Hotel in BGC, Fort Bonifacio from March 9-10, 2023. The event aimed to highlight the crucial role of cities in achieving inclusive, sustainable economic growth and urban development, and to bring local and international partners together to share their expertise and enrich cities' potential in achieving Sustainable Development Goals (SDGs).
The event was attended by city mayors, city planning officers, and Gender Development (GAD) focal persons from different cities in the country. The event coincided with the 2023 National Women's Month celebration, and Mayor Lani Cayetano, as the LCP's Women's Sector Representative, delivered an empowering video message emphasizing the importance of gender equality in achieving sustainability.
Senator Pia Cayetano, Chairperson of the Senate Committee on Sustainable Development, personally attended the event and stressed the importance of true sustainability in all sectors, including gender, education, and health policies to successfully achieve the SDGs.
The event featured three main presentations: Creating a Smoke-Free Generation; 5 Things Cities Get Wrong About Mobility; and the Galing Pook Foundation Best Practices Awards. The latter recognized the best practices of LGUs in local governance in promoting sustainable development.
The event's successful hosting showcased the City of Taguig's commitment to sustainability and the importance of collaboration among LGUs in achieving sustainable development.
